Ebenezer Integrated Care & Rehab (EICR) serves seniors with long-term, transitional, and dementia care needs in the heart of downtown St. Paul. As part of Fairview's Community Health and Wellness Hub, EICR is committed to delivering innovative, collaborative care. The Fairview Community Health and Wellness Hub opened in 2022 to deliver a variety of services to the community—from primary and mental health care to enrichment options for seniors, food access programs, and community gathering spaces. The Hub brings Fairview services together with local organizations—including Minnesota Community Care and Sanneh Foundation—to make it easier for people to access what they need to be well. The Staffing Coordinator maintains the staffing schedule and documents attendance for the nursing department. Schedule includes; 80 hours every two weeks ; full-time

Responsibilities

  • Maintains Nursing staff schedule
  • Updates master nursing schedules in the computer
  • Communicates staffing schedule changes
  • Communicates open positions and takes necessary steps to fill positions promptly
  • Knowledge and understanding of overtime and bonuses per facility protocol, policies, and Administration direction
  • Coordinate and manage staffing procedures and scheduling of nursing personnel
  • Develops Bi-Weekly and daily schedule under the direction of the DON and according to pre-established time frames
  • Determines PPL eligibility and grants or denies based on facility policy
  • Determines staffing needs/open positions
  • Approves/denies employees' schedule exchange
  • Minimize temporary agency usage by posting needs/open positions lists on a timely basis, utilizing an availability list, and calling employees before contacting a temporary staffing agency
  • Processes timecards, assuring that time punches match each employee's schedule
  • Notifies DON of status changes and permanent schedule change requests
  • Document attendance/tardiness reports, notifying supervisors of individuals requiring disciplinary action
  • Maintains master attendance file
  • Reports attendance issues to the appropriate supervisor
  • Monitors the status of on-call and pool employees
  • Notifies DON of employee attendance concerns
  • Other duties as assigned and directed: Assists staff development with mandatory meetings, on-site orientation and education, set up of phone calls, and scheduling
